Traditional Ingredients of Uskoplje

When you step into the vibrant world of Uskoplje’s cuisine, you quickly realize that the heart of each dish beats with locally sourced ingredients. Imagine walking through a bustling market, where the air is filled with the aroma of fresh vegetables and fragrant herbs. Here, tomatoes, peppers, and zucchini are not just food; they are the very essence of Uskoplje’s culinary identity. These ingredients are often grown in the fertile soil of the region, kissed by the sun and nurtured by the local farmers who take pride in their produce.

Herbs play a crucial role in enhancing the flavors of traditional dishes. You’ll often find parsley, oregano, and rosemary sprinkled generously, adding a burst of freshness that elevates even the simplest meals. The locals believe that cooking is an art form, and every meal tells a story, one that is deeply rooted in the culture and history of the Balkans.

Moreover, Uskoplje’s culinary landscape is enriched with unique ingredients like cornmeal used in polenta and cheese from local dairies, which adds a creamy texture to many dishes. The use of smoked meats and preserved vegetables not only reflects the traditional preservation methods but also showcases the resourcefulness of the people. Signature Dishes and Their Stories

Signature Dishes and Their Stories

When you step into the heart of Uskoplje, you’re not just entering a town; you’re diving into a culinary treasure chest filled with stories, flavors, and traditions that have been passed down through generations. Each dish tells a tale, a delicious narrative that reflects the rich cultural tapestry of the Balkans. For instance, take the beloved Begova čorba, or Bey’s soup, a creamy, hearty dish that combines tender meat and vegetables, simmered to perfection. Legend has it that this dish was once served to the nobility, making it a symbol of hospitality and warmth.

Another iconic dish is Sarma, which consists of cabbage leaves stuffed with a savory mixture of minced meat and rice. This dish is not just food; it’s a family affair. Picture this: generations of family members gathering around the kitchen, each adding their unique twist, creating a bond that’s as rich as the flavors in the pot. It’s a testament to how food can bring people together, transcending time and space.

Moreover, let’s not forget about Baklava, a sweet treat that’s as layered as its history. With its crispy pastry and luscious honey syrup, it’s often served during celebrations, symbolizing joy and prosperity. But what makes it truly special in Uskoplje is the local twist—sometimes infused with nuts sourced from nearby orchards, making every bite a delightful surprise.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What are the key ingredients in Uskoplje cuisine?

    Uskoplje cuisine is known for its fresh, locally sourced ingredients. You can expect to find a variety of vegetables, aromatic herbs, and unique spices that bring out the rich flavors of each dish. Ingredients like peppers, potatoes, and beans are staples, while herbs such as parsley and dill add that special touch!

  • What are some signature dishes from Uskoplje?

    Some iconic dishes include pita (savory pies), sarma (cabbage rolls), and čevapi (grilled minced meat). Each dish has its own story, often passed down through generations, reflecting the cultural heritage and traditions of the region. It’s like tasting history with every bite!
